How to Add a Due Date field to a workflow

Effortlessly monitor due dates in your workflow with Assess.one's powerful Due Date field, featuring customizable settings.

Introduction

The Due Date field is designed to provide you with the flexibility to use due dates only when they are required instead of forcing the need for a due date field. Although the Due Date field is similar in functionality to the Date & Time Picker field, the Due Date field provides you with extra functionality to monitor the due dates of assessment workflows through widgets whilst also allowing you to inherit data from due dates across multiple workflows stages. For example, if you have a 3 stage workflow and you have a Due Date field on Stage 1, Stage 2 and Stage 3, when changing the due date on either stage the date will update on the Due Date field on all stages making it a common field.

Don't have an assess.one account? Try for FREE and publish your workflows in minutes!
Try for Free

Example Usage

The Due Date field is primarily used to set and monitor a due date. This is useful when you need to:

  • Set and monitor a due date for the entire workflow
  • Set and monitor a due date for specific workflow stages

If your workflows are time critical and need to be completed by a certain date and/or time, then the Due Date field is a very useful field to include in your workflow.

Steps

  1. Open an existing workflow or create a new workflow.
  2. Click on the "Drop Date Field" option on the component toolbar to add the field to your workflow canvas.
  3. Configure the settings of the field in the "Date Picker Settings" pane on the right hand side of the flow builder.
  4. Drag the "Date Picker" field to the desired location on the stage canvas.
  5. Use the grab handles to change the width of the "Date Picker" field.
Add Due Date field to workflow
Add the "Due Date" field to your workspace canvas

Settings

The following general settings are available to configure the "Due Date" field:

  • Label: Add a text label to display text above the due date field. Delete this text if you do not want a label to be displayed.
  • Due: If you would like to automatically determine the number of days that the workflow assessment is due when the assessment is created, enter the number of days and the date will automatically be set based on the number of days. If you would like to automatically specify a specific date that the workflow assessment will be due, set the specific future date.
  • Date Format: Select the date format that you would like to be recorded when selecting a date. Options include dd/mm/yyyy, dd/mm/yy, mm/dd/yyyy, mm/dd/yy, dd Month yyyy and dd Mon yyyy.
  • Options: Set the date and time picker field options to allow selection of the date only, time only or both date and time.
  • Range: The range determines which periods of time are available for selection in the date and time picker field. By default, the "Any date or time" option is selected allowing for the selection of any time or date in the past or into the future. Select the "After present time" option if you only want to allow the selection of future dates and time or select the "Before present time" option if you only want to allow the selection of dates and time in the past.
  • Picker: The picker option is a setting to display the number of months to display when searching for a date on selection. By default, a calendar displaying one month of dates will be displayed. Select the "Two months" option to display dates spanning two months,
  • Viewers: By default, anyone will be able to view the due date field. If you would like to restrict who can view the field when completing assessments, select the role or individual people from the "Viewers" drop-down field.
  • Editors: By default, anyone will be able to select the due date value. If you would like to restrict who can select a date and time picker value when completing assessments, select the role or individual people from the "Editors" drop-down field.
  • Inherit Settings: This option is unique to the due date field. Use this option where you would like to display the same due date value anywhere within your workflow. For example, if you have multiple stages in your workflow where you would like to display the due date, simply select the other date date field. When updating one of the due date fields then all the due date fields will be updated. This option makes multiple due date fields a "common" field.
  • Display Data From: If you have another due date field, you can automatically populate the value from that field to display in another due date field. This is particularly useful where you have a workflow stage which is a confirmation page based on previously input values to summarise what was input. Click on the "Display data from" dropdown to select another due date field. The field will be read only when displaying data from another field.
  • Inactive: When clicking the "Inactive" checkbox, the due date field will be displayed in an inactive state and the field will not accept any input.
  • Required: Select the "Required" checkbox if a selection is required in the due date field when completing assessments. Validation will occur when someone clicks on a button where the button's "Check required" setting is selected.
  • Required Text: If the "Required" checkbox is selected a message will appear below the due date field advising that the field requires a selection on button click. Change the "Required text" to display your own custom validation message.
  • Add to assess table: Select this option if you would like the field value to be displayed as a column when viewing all assessments under the "Assess" page.
Due date field settings
Due Date field settings

Conditional Display

Conditional display provides you with the ability to display the due date field when certain conditions are met with other fields in the workflow. For example, if I add a radio button field to the workflow canvas with the options Yes, No and Other. When someone selects "Other" then the due date field will be displayed.

  • IF: Select the "Field" option from the drop-down (currently the only value available)
  • Field: Select a radio, dropdown or checkbox field that has been added to any stage canvas of your workflow.
  • Equals: Select the field value that will result in the due date field being displayed.
Due date field conditional settings
Conditional display set for the "Due Date" field.

Summary

The Due Date field is a flexible, powerful and easy to use field to add to your workflows where you need to monitor due dates for any use case as part of your workflow. Remember to use the "Inherit settings" setting where you would like a common due date field across your workflow.